Another thing I like about it compared to my other safes is the fact it isn't easy to tip over. A lot of people talk about anchoring a safe to the floor. The biggest problem with that is a lot of homes that are built on concrete slabs have plumbing pipe running through them. The homeowner doesn't know where these pipes are located. Drilling into the slab to secure anchor bolts without knowing the exact location of these pipes is extremely dangerous. If you were to hit a water pipe you would have a monumental disaster on your hands that would be expensive to clean up and repair! I don't even want to think about hitting a gas pipe with an electric drill!

A free standing gun safe is an open target for kids / vandals who break in. For many what they can't steal they would like nothing better to destroy. It wouldn't take much for 2 people to push a gun safe over on to it's side. Doing so would severely damage the guns inside it. With the chest type "safes" this is all but impossible.   Bill T.

unless you have  raidant heating, there is no pipe in the slabs.  they are underneath the slab. its been against the UBC since there has been a a UBC.

now if you have a post tentioned slab( there will be a imprint or a plate some where in your garage or on the outside)  you have to be very carful not to hit one of the cables.  cutting/danaging one of those could lead to the foundation cracking apart.  when that happens, you must jack that house and re do the foundation.
